Software Engineer
About the Role
Our world-leading Time & Frequency department is seeking a Software Engineer.
This is an exceptional opportunity to join the global authority in precision timing at a defining moment for UK digital infrastructure.
Backed by a government investment of £180 million in the National Timing Centre (NTC) programme , we are developing a world-first resilient time distribution capability that will provide industry with a robust complement to satellite systems such as GPS – which are increasingly vulnerable to disruption from solar storms, jamming and spoofing. This will underpin essential services; including (though not limited to)
- Telecommunications,
- Online banking,
- Emergency response,
- Transport networks, and
- Wider digital and data-driven operations,
Together, these services form the backbone of modern society - and you will help ensure they remain secure, reliable and robust even if global navigation satellite systems fail.
Key responsibilities:As Software Engineer , you’ll collaborate with prominent Scientists and Engineers to develop and implement innovative, production-ready software to time, quality, and cost.
- Collaborating with senior stakeholders to ensure that software aligns with business strategy- Working cross-functionally to gather project requirements, analyse feasibility, and provide technical recommendations
- Working as an Agile Software team, taking responsibility for your own deliverables, and reviewing the work of others
- Code reviews to ensure cleanliness, efficiency and quality through testing and debugging, and adherence of standards throughout the software development cycle
- Risk communication and mitigation
- Explaining complex tech concepts and advisory to internal and external stakeholders, from technical and non-technical backgrounds
About You
To be successful in this role, you will have the following skills, experience, and qualifications:
- Recent and proven experience in design and delivery of production-ready software- Degree-level educated in Computer Science, Mathematics (or closely related discipline), or equivalent experience
- Risk management and communication
Essential technical skills:
- Python- GIT / Linux
- DevOps methodology
- Azure
- Docker
Highly-desirable technical skills:
- Telegraf/Influx/Grafana stack- CI/CD practices
We actively recruit citizens of all backgrounds, but the nature of our work in specific departments means that nationality, residency and security requirements can be more tightly defined than others. You will be asked about this throughout the recruitment process.
To work at NPL, you will need to obtain BPSS security clearance. However, to work in this role in the Time & Frequency department, you will need to have an SC clearance with no restrictions, or you must have the ability to obtain an SC clearance.
Please note: Applications will be reviewed, and interviews conducted throughout the duration of this advert therefore we may at any time bring the closing date forward. We encourage all interested applicants to apply as soon as practical.About Us
The National Physical Laboratory (NPL) is a world-leading centre of excellence that provides cutting-edge measurement science, engineering and technology to underpin prosperity and quality of life in the UK. Find out more about what it is like working here - The measure of us - Overview
NPL and DSIT have strong commitments to diversity and equality of opportunity, and welcome applications from candidates irrespective of their background, gender, race, sexual orientation, religion, or age, providing they meet the required criteria. Applications from women, disabled and black, Asian and minority ethnic candidates in particular are encouraged. All disabled candidates (as defined by the Equality Act 2010) who satisfy the minimum criteria for the role will be guaranteed an interview under the Disability Confident Scheme.
At NPL, we believe our success is a result of the diversity and talent of our people. We strive to nurture and respect individuals to ensure everyone feels valued by treating everyone on the basis of their own individual merits and abilities regardless of their own or perceived identity, as part of our commitment to diversity & inclusion, we ensure we’re creating an environment where all our colleagues feel supported and welcome. More about this on our Diversity & Inclusion page.
We are committed to the health and well-being of our employees. Flexible working and social activities are embedded in our culture to create a positive work-life balance, along with a broad range of rewards, benefits and recognition Our values are at the heart of what we do, and they shape the way we interact, develop our people and celebrate success. To ensure everyone has an equal chance, we’re always willing to make reasonable adjustments to the recruitment process. If you would like to discuss, please contact us.
Recommended Jobs
Group Legal Director - Property Development, Asset Management
The responsibilities with this senior role include: Legal Service Delivery Lead on key strategic and complex legal matters relating to real estate development, property/asset management and rural…
Front of House Staff - London Venues
Job Details Job Title: Front of House Staff Location: London (across 4 venues in the city) Salary: £13.85 per hour Contract: Zero-hour contract, working across venues that have a 7 day a w…
Media Studies ECT - Outstanding Mixed School in Lambeth
Media Studies ECT – Outstanding Mixed School in Lambeth (January Start) Location: Lambeth Start Date: January 2026 Contract Type: Full-time, Permanent Salary: MPS (ECT) – Paid to Scale …
Network Engineer
About Us Visa is a world leader in payments technology, facilitating transactions between consumers, merchants, financial institutions and government entities across more than 200 countries and te…
SEN English Teacher
Integrity Education Solutions are supporting the appointment of an experienced SEN English Teacher for a brand-new specialist SEN provision opening in South London from September 2026. The new scho…
Group Risk Account Handler
Salary: £30,000 – £55,000 (DOE, skills & track record) Join a leading brokerage and take your Group Risk expertise to the next level. We’re looking for a skilled Group Risk Account Handler w…
Looking for a dog walker to take my dog for a 60-minute walk
Hi there, I’m looking for a reliable dog walker to take my friendly terrier for a 60-minute stroll around the local park. He’s well-behaved, up-to-date on vaccines, and gets along with other dogs. I’d…
Corporate Account Manager
Established in June 2000, with a current turnover of £150 million, Storm has grown from strength to strength as a focused IT value-added reseller. Our aim is to deliver exceptional service to our cus…
Power Platform Consultant
Job Title: Power Platform Consultant Location: Hybrid working – Based in London Help empower millions to achieve more by joining a world-class Microsoft consultancy. WM Reply is the Re…
Senior Account Executive
SENIOR ACCOUNT EXECUTIVE We’re looking for individuals who have experience of executing client projects in an account, ensuring high quality that exceeds client expectations and ensuring projects …